More Information

THE World Ranking: 105

English courses available
View 4 Industrial Management courses
8349
Views
66
Favourites
Review(1)
courses

Refine by

  • Subject:
  • Industrial Management
  • Country:
  • UK
  • England
  • Study level:
  • Postgraduate
  • Masters Degrees

Filter your results

close